Transaction 570366de396580172f6f21a24a95cba10f2c3e9c464eb5825cc29666af98fe1a

block
85f6a80a51f7a449d0db8e086010d341fe12e4c73c5069a4b83ea2d443d6c505

1 Input

2 Outputs